4 tips from your dentist for September

Back to school requires good planning not only for parents but also for children. Thus, it is important to pick up on good habits from the start. We thought we’d share with you some tips to give your child the best oral care throughout the year.

Among the little things that you can achieve, including healthy food in the lunch box is probably the easiest. Not only your child will find essential nutrients for his development but also you can also create a lunch with easy to prepare foods that you probably already have on hand. Cubes of cheese, yogurt, vegetable sticks or fresh fruit: Here are examples of foods to incorporate. This will prevent your child from consuming commercial foods (granola bars, cookies, etc.) that often contain more sugar than nutrients, and sugar …. is the enemy of teeth!

Also, do not put in your child’s lunch box sticky foods or sugary drinks (juice, soft drinks or sports drink). From a dental standpoint, these items are high in acidity, which can cause erosion of the teeth. Why not fall back on the most appropriate drink, the most economical, easiest to find and definitely the best for your health: good old water! Indeed, it represents the best option for hydration, regardless of the time of day. Use a fun reusable bottle that you can insert into your child’s lunch box.

4 tips from your dentist for September

  1. Why not schedule your child’s annual appointment at eh beginning of school year? This will prevent the busy periods of class and exams.
  2. Just as for sugary drinks, avoid sugary snacks. Indeed, candy, granola bars or candies cause cavities.
  3. Create a space in your child’s backpack for a small toothbrush and a tube of toothpaste. He will be able to take care of his teeth after lunch.
  4. Back to school also means back to sport activities. Consider a mouth guard to protect your child from injury to the lips, cheeks, tongue, teeth or jaw.
